titleOfInvention Three-dimensional particles and related methods including interference lithography
abstract The present invention generally provides compositions comprising particles having various sizes and shapes, as well as methods for production of such particles. Particles of the invention may comprise complex, multi-valent structures. In some cases, the particles may have at least one concave surface. The present invention may advantageously provide facile, high yielding methods for producing complex particle structures. The particles may exhibit novel optical or mechanical properties, making them useful as photonic crystals, phononic crystals, mictrotrusses and microframes, multivalent colloidal particles, delivery agents, or the like.
